Abstract
- In the paper, an equilibrium problem for an elastic body with a crack crossing a thin inclusion at some point is analyzed. As a result, the crack divides the inclusion of two parts. One part of the inclusion is a rigid and the other is an elastic. The elastic inclusion is modeled by a Bernoulli – Euler beam. The conjugation conditions of these inclusions at a given point are considered. To exclude a mutual penetration between inclusions, inequality type boundary conditions are imposed. Nonlinear boundary conditions are also considered at the crack faces.The main goal of the paper is to justify a passage to the limit as the rigidity parameter of the thin inclusion goes to infinity.
